Capacity note: Gridwell's spreadsheet export path buffers entire row groups in memory before streaming, so plugin authors should assume peak usage scales with the widest sheet, not total rows. Keep custom cell formatters allocation-free where possible, and prefer the chunked writer API introduced in Gridwell 4.2. The tuning constants below govern buffer sizing and flush cadence.

tuning constants:
TIERS = {
    "sorion": 670,
    "istax": 547,
}

## Approvals: Spreadsheet Export Memory Usage

Large exports from LedgerNest can spike worker memory above 2 GB. Support must not raise a customer's export row limit without approval, since one oversized job can evict other tenants on the Dunmoor cluster. Approvals are granted case by case after a memory estimate. All limit-increase requests go to the approver named below.

named custodian: Ulaix Wenwyn

**Sidecar: metrix-agg dropping samples**

Symptom: gaps in dashboards for services on the Corvane cluster. Cause: the metrix-agg sidecar's flush buffer fills when the upstream collector lags; samples drop silently. Check `flush_backlog` gauge first — anything over 10k means trouble. Mitigation: bump `buffer_mb` to 64 and restart the sidecar only, not the pod. Permanent fix is batched flushing, tracked for next sprint. Repro steps in the runbook. To pull backlog stats from the collector admin endpoint, authenticate with the token below.

portal login ticket: eyJhbGciOiJIUzI1NiIsInR5cCI6IkpXVCJ9.eyJzdWIiOiIwEOsktwVNwIn0.-UJU3fdyyCgG

The Perchstand kiosk watchdog exposes a heartbeat endpoint that plugins must ping every 30 seconds; missing three consecutive intervals triggers a kiosk restart. Plugin authors should register their plugin identifier at startup and include it in each ping. All watchdog requests go through the internal relay, which requires authentication. For sandbox testing, authenticate your pings with the key below.

gateway credential: kto23_LX9A4ys6i4nzHtpOLNLodKK